    A well established SEN School are looking for a Pastoral Manager to join the team.

    We are seeking a committed Pastoral Manager to play a key role in ensuring our pupils feel safe, supported, and ready to learn. This role leads our pastoral systems, coordinates multi‑agency support around each child, and promotes positive behaviour, attendance, and wellbeing. By taking a trauma‑informed, relationship‑focused approach, the Pastoral Manager helps remove barriers to learning and ensures every young person can thrive socially, emotionally, and academically.

    If you are passionate about building strong relationships, championing inclusion, and delivering trauma‑informed, child‑centred support, we would love to hear from you.

    We strongly encourage any current employee who is interested in the role to apply.

    As Pastoral Manager you will….

    • Ensuring effective multi‑agency working, coherent support plans, and strong communication across the school.
    • Lead on the school delivering pastoral and behaviour approaches, using trauma‑informed and relational methods to support pupils with SEND and SEMH needs.
    • Monitor and improve attendance and welfare, including early help strategies, home visits, and removing barriers to engagement.
    • Act as a key safeguarding lead, identifying concerns, maintaining rigorous records, and working in line with KCSIE and statutory guidance.
    • Build strong relationships with pupils and families, offering emotional support, regular communication, and solution‑focused approaches.
    • Use data and reporting to inform practice, track patterns in behaviour/attendance, and contribute to school improvement and compliance.
